Overview:

A Locum Critical Care Physician Assistant is a healthcare professional who provides medical care to critically ill patients in a hospital setting. They work closely with physicians and other healthcare professionals to provide comprehensive care to patients in need of critical care.

Detailed Job Description:

A Locum Critical Care Physician Assistant is responsible for providing medical care to critically ill patients in a hospital setting. This includes performing physical examinations, ordering and interpreting laboratory tests, diagnosing and treating illnesses, providing patient education, and providing support to the patient and their family. They must also be able to recognize and respond to changes in the patient’s condition and provide appropriate interventions.
